Research Roars

CAFNR faculty members have received the following recent grants (listed by Principal Investigator):

Jaime Barros-Rios, Dissecting the molecular basis of the sfe mutants in maize for root system development, Natl Inst of Food and Ag, 2/1/26-1/31/28, $299,931

Xi Xiong, Utilization of neem, a novel biopesticide for enhancing sweetpotato storage, Mo Dept of Ag (Ag Marketing Service), 11/1/25-10/31/27, $44,047

Henry Nguyen, Climate-adaptive soybean: root architecture and plasticity tuning for nutrient capture and stress resilience, United Soybean Board, 10/1/25-9/30/26, $231,914

Stephen Mukembo, Excellence in Research: Promote Rural Resilience after High Inflation and Interest rate Induced by Covid-19 Pandemic, Lincoln University (NSF), 9/1/25-6/30/28, $90,327

Tim Reinbott, Identifying Soil Health Deficiencies in Soybean Production to Develop a “One Health” Sustainable Soybean Production System, United Soybean Board, 10/1/25-3/31/27, $205,311
